Karen Dobelstein Thompson of Charlestown RI, daughter of the late Dr. Russell and E. Millicent (Porter) Dobelstein passed away December 26th, 2024.
Karen was an amazing person, with a heart like no other, who never back downed with whatever life threw at her.
She worked hard for her career traveling and living in many states of our country, capping off being the CFO of The Venture Capital Fund of New England in Boston MA, and finally making her way back home to Charlestown RI, as the Finance Director of the Bar Association of Rhode Island.
She is survived by her husband Craig Thompson, her two children, Derek McWade of Boston, Massachusetts, and Michelle McWade of Voluntown, CT, four stepchildren, Kelly, Jenn, Allyson, and Brian and their partners, and all of her grandchildren. She’s also survived by a brother Ronald Dobelstein and his clan, her sister Deb Dobelstein Ballard and her clan, a goddaughter Melanie M. Goodwin and her great niece Baylin. She loved her family to her core and came home to Charlestown for them and her love of the beach.
What are the comments you will hear about Karen when you mention her name -Her smile, her dimples, the blue eyes, the way she made you feel about yourself, her laugh, her love of life. She will be missed terribly but will live on in our hearts and the warmth of the sun.
Burial will be private. The family will host a celebration of life in the coming months and will use social media to inform all she loved.
In lieu of flowers please make donations in her memory to St Andrew Lutheran Church, Charlestown, RI.
